@media screen and (min-width: 1400px) {
    .container {
        max-width: 1300px;
    }
}

 @media (min-width: 1200px) {
      .navbar .dropdown:hover .dropdown-menu {
        display: block;
        margin-top: 0;
      }
    }

/*
====================================
Medium Screen - Others
====================================
*/
@media screen and (min-width: 992px) and (max-width: 1200px) {



.swiper-button-next {
	right: -20px;
}

.swiper-button-prev {
	left: -20px;
}

























}

/*
====================================
Small Screen - Tablate
====================================
*/
@media screen and (min-width: 768px) and (max-width: 991px) {



.personal-loan-area {
	padding-top: 50px;
	padding-bottom: 100px;
}
.personal-loan-wrapper h2 {
	font-size: 25px;
}
.apply-loan-card {
	padding: 30px 5px;
}
.loan-type-tab-wrapper {
	padding-top: 30px;
}

.loan-terms-block svg {
	height: 24px;
	width: 24px !important;
	flex: 0 0 24px;
}
.loan-terms-block {
	padding-inline: 25px;
}
.loan-terms-block ul li span {
	font-size: 14px;
}
.costuri-block p {
	font-size: 14px;
}


/* loan type list area  */


.loan-type-list {
	flex-wrap: wrap;
	justify-content: center;
}
.loan-type-list a {
	width: 100%;
	max-width: 370px;
}

.choose-loan-type-area {
	padding-block: 40px;
}
.choose-loan-type-wp .section-title {
	margin-bottom: 24px;
}

/* how work area  */

.how-work-area {
	padding-block: 50px;
}



/* faq area  */

.faq-area {
	padding-block: 60px;
}
.faq-wrapper .section-title {
	margin-bottom: 50px;
}

/* faq area  */

.testimonals-area {
	padding-block: 20px;
}
.testimonals-area .section-top {
	padding-bottom: 60px;
}
.testimonals-review-wp {
	grid-template-columns: repeat(2 , 1fr);
}


/* pertners area  */

.pertners-area {
	padding-block: 20px;
}

.partners-wrapper {
	gap: 20px;
}


/* footer area  */
.footer-top-wrapper {
	grid-template-columns: repeat(2, 1fr);
}
.calculatin-example-footer {
	flex-direction: column;
}
.example-footer-left {
	width: fit-content;
}
.example-right {
	width: 100%;
}



/* cum platesc creditul page  */

.howPayLoan-wrapper h2 {
	font-size: 54px;
}
.howPayLoan-wrapper h4 {
	font-size: 20.68px;
}
.howPayLoan-wrapper p {
	font-size: 17px;
}
.single-pay-methood .pay-icon {
	width: 60px;
	height: 60px;
	padding: 10px;
}

.single-pay-methood .pay-methood-info {
	padding-left: 20px;
	padding-top: 18px;
	gap: 20px;
}



/* application process area  */

.application-process-area {
	padding-block: 70px;
}

.line-credit-wp h2 {
	font-size: 40px;
}



/*============ BLOG PAGE ========= */

.blog-hero-inner-wp h2 {
	font-size: 35px;
}

.article-list-wrapper {
	grid-template-columns: repeat(2, 1fr);
	grid-column-gap: 24px;
}


/* success area  */


.sucess-block-content h1 {
	font-size: 54px;
}






}

/*
====================================
Small Screen - Mobile
====================================
*/
@media screen and (max-width: 767px) {	



/* search pop  */

.search-pop-wrapper {
	max-width: 500px;
}
.search-pop-wrapper h2 {
	font-size: 32px;
}



/* personal loan area  */

.personal-loan-area {
	padding-top: 50px;
	padding-bottom: 185px;
	background-position: bottom center;
	background-size: contain;
}
.personal-loan-wrapper h2 {
	font-size: 20px;
}
.apply-loan-card {
	padding: 30px 5px;
}
.loan-type-tab-wrapper {
	padding-top: 20px;
}

.loan-terms-block svg {
	height: 24px;
	width: 24px !important;
	flex: 0 0 24px;
}
.loan-terms-block {
	padding-inline: 15px;
}
.loan-terms-block ul li span {
	font-size: 14px;
}
.costuri-block p {
	font-size: 14px;
}
.loan-card .title {
	font-size: 20.4px;
}
.amount-display {
	font-size: 22.8px;
}
.calculate-costuri-card {
	margin-top: 20px;
	gap: 15px;
}
.js-amount-slider::-moz-range-thumb {
    height: 20px;
    width: 20px;
}
.loan-type-nav {
	padding: 10px;
}
.loan-card {
	padding: 15px;
}


/* why choose us  */
.why-choose-us {
	background: #fff;
}
.why-choose-us-wrapper .section-title {
	margin-bottom: 24px;
}
.section-title h2 br {
	display: none;
}
.section-title h2 {
	font-size: 30px;
}
.why-choose-us-wrapper p {
	font-size: 16px;
}
.single-acces-box p {
	font-size: 14px;
}

/* loan type list area  */


.loan-type-list {
	flex-wrap: wrap;
	justify-content: center;
}
.loan-type-list a {
	width: 100%;
	max-width: 370px;
}

.choose-loan-type-area {
	padding-block: 40px;
}
.choose-loan-type-wp .section-title {
	margin-bottom: 0;
}
.choose-loan-type-wp p {
	font-size: 16px;
}

.why-choose-us {
	padding-bottom: 30px;
}



/* how work area  */

.how-work-area {
	padding-block: 50px;
}
.how-work-wrapper {
	flex-direction: column;
}

.how-work-area.how-work-two .how-work-wrapper {
	flex-direction: column-reverse;
}
.how-work-left {
	gap: 15px;
}
.how-work-left p {
	font-size: 16px;
}



/* faq area  */

.faq-area {
	padding-block: 50px;
}
.faq-wrapper .section-title {
	margin-bottom: 30px;
}
.faq-answaer p {
	font-size: 16px;
}
.faq-header h4 {
	font-size: 18px;
}


/* faq area  */

.testimonals-area {
	padding-block: 20px;
}
.testimonals-area .section-top {
	padding-bottom: 40px;
}
.testimonals-review-wp {
	grid-template-columns: repeat(1 , 1fr);
}
.single-review-item {
	gap: 15px;
	padding: 24px;
}
.review-content p {
	font-size: 16px;
}

/* pertners area  */

.pertners-area {
	padding-block: 20px;
}

.partners-wrapper {
	gap: 20px;
}

.swiper-button-next {
	right: -20px;
}

.swiper-button-prev {
	left: -20px;
}

/* footer area  */
.footer-top-wrapper {
	grid-template-columns: repeat(2, 1fr);
}
.calculatin-example-footer {
	flex-direction: column;
}
.example-footer-left {
	width: fit-content;
}
.example-right {
	width: 100%;
}


/* cum platesc creditul page  */

.howPayLoan-wrapper h2 {
	font-size: 45px;
	margin-bottom: 20px;
}
.howPayLoan-wrapper h4 {
	font-size: 16.68px;
	margin-bottom: 20px;
}
.howPayLoan-wrapper p {
	font-size: 14.4px;
}
.single-pay-methood .pay-icon {
	width: 60px;
	height: 60px;
	padding: 10px;
}

.single-pay-methood .pay-methood-info {
	padding-left: 5px;
	padding-top: 15px;
	gap: 20px;
}
.pay-methood-list .serial-letter {
	display: none;
}

.howPayLoan-area {
	padding-block: 50px;
}

/* application process area  */

.application-process-area {
	padding-block: 70px;
}

.line-credit-wp h2 {
	font-size: 30px;
}
.application-process-wrapper h2 {
	font-size: 24px;
}
.application-process-wrapper {
	gap: 20px;
}
.application-process-wrapper ul {
	font-size: 18px;
}
.application-process-wrapper p {
	font-size: 16px;
}


/*============ BLOG PAGE ========= */

.blog-hero-inner-wp h2 {
	font-size: 32px;
}
.blog-hero-inner-wp {
	position: unset;
	padding: 24px;
}
.blog-hero-content a {
	flex-direction: column;
}

.blog-nav {
	flex-wrap: wrap;
	justify-content: center;
}

/*============ BLOG PAGE ========= */

.blog-hero-inner-wp h2 {
	font-size: 35px;
}

.article-list-wrapper {
	grid-template-columns: repeat(2, 1fr);
	grid-column-gap: 24px;
}
.letest-article {
	padding-block: 50px;
}
.letest-article-wrapper {
	gap: 40px;
}


/* about page  */

.about-us-wrapper {
	gap: 60px;
}
.about-us-area {
	padding-block: 60px;
}
.about-inner-block h3 {
	font-size: 24px;
}
.about-content-wp {
	gap: 45px;
}
.about-inner-block p {
	font-size: 16px;
}
.success-wrapper {
	grid-template-columns: repeat(1, 1fr);
	padding-top: 55px;
	gap: 30px;
}
.sucess-block-content h1 {
	font-size: 40px;
}
.our-success-area {
	padding-block: 60px;
}
.advantage-area {
	padding-block: 60px;
}
.help-area {
	padding-block: 60px;
}

.help-wrapper p {
	font-size: 16px;
}


/* faq page  */

.faq-hero-area {
	padding-block: 60px;
}
.faq-hero-wrapper h1 {
	font-size: 40px;
}
.faq-section {
	padding-block: 60px;
}

.faq-section-wrapper {
	padding-top: 60px;
	flex-direction: column;
}

/* responsabil page  */

.responsabil-top h2 {
	font-size: 32px;
}
.responsabil-area {
	padding-block: 50px;
}

.responsabil-inner-block h2 {
	font-size: 28px;
}

.terms-top {
	padding-bottom: 40px;
}
.error-area p {
	font-size: 18px;
}

}

/*
====================================
Xtra Small Screen - Small Mobile
====================================
*/
@media screen and (max-width: 576px) {

/* search pop  */

.search-pop-wrapper {
	max-width: 500px;
    padding-inline: 15px;
}
.search-pop-wrapper h2 {
	font-size: 32px;
}
.searchbar-card {
	flex-direction: column;
}




/* why choose us  */

.access-list-wp {
	grid-template-columns: repeat(2, 1fr);
	gap: 20px;
}
.why-choose-us-wrapper p {
	font-size: 14px;
}
.section-title h2 {
	font-size: 20px;
}

.why-choose-us-wrapper .section-title {
	margin-bottom: 0;
}
.why-choose-us {
	padding-block: 60px;
	padding-bottom: 20px;
}

.choose-loan-type-wp p {
	font-size: 14px;
}
.loan-type-list a h4 {
	font-size: 16px;
}

.how-work-left ul {
	font-size: 16px;
    padding-block: 10px;
}

.how-work-area {
	padding-block: 30px;
}


.swiper-button-next {
	right: 0;
}

.swiper-button-prev {
	left: 0;
}


/* cum platesc creditul page  */

.howPayLoan-wrapper h2 {
	font-size: 30px;
}

.single-pay-methood .pay-icon {
	width: 48px;
	height: 48px;
	padding: 10px;
}

.single-pay-methood .pay-methood-info {
	padding-left: 5px;
	padding-top: 0;
	gap: 20px;
}

.howPayLoan-area {
	padding-block: 30px;
}
.pay-methood-list {
	gap: 16px;
	padding-top: 30px;
}


/* application process area  */

.application-process-area {
	padding-block: 40px;
}

.line-credit-wp h2 {
	font-size: 26px;
}
.application-process-wrapper h2 {
	font-size: 18px;
}
.application-process-wrapper {
	gap: 16px;
}

.application-process-wrapper ul {
	font-size: 16px;
}

/*============ BLOG PAGE ========= */


.article-list-wrapper {
	grid-template-columns: repeat(1, 1fr);
	grid-row-gap: 18px;
}
.letest-article {
	padding-block: 50px;
}
.letest-article-wrapper {
	gap: 40px;
}


/* about page  */

.advantage-wrapper {
	padding-top: 45px;
	grid-template-columns: repeat(2, 1fr);
}

.help-actions-btns {
	gap: 20px;
	padding-top: 0;
	flex-direction: column;
}


/* faq page  */

.faq-hero-area {
	padding-block: 60px;
}
.faq-hero-wrapper h1 {
	font-size: 32px;
}
.faq-section {
	padding-block: 60px;
}

.faq-section-wrapper {
	padding-top: 48px;
	flex-direction: column;
}
.faq-inner-wrapper {
	gap: 34px;
}






}